Chaotic Image Encryption Algorithm Based on Pseudo-Random Bit Sequence and DNA Plane

Xingyuan Wang,Hongyu Zhao,Yutao Hou,Chao Luo,Yingqian Zhang,Chunpeng Wang
DOI: https://doi.org/10.1142/s0217984919502634
2019-01-01
Modern Physics Letters B
Abstract:In this paper, a new chaotic image encryption algorithm based on pseudo-random bit sequence and DNA plane is proposed. The coupled map lattice (CML) is applied to design a pseudo-random bit sequence generation (PBSG) system and use the system to generate the random sequence needed in the encryption process. The initial values and parameters of the system are generated by the SHA-256 hash algorithm combined with given keys. Firstly, the plane image is decomposed into four DNA planes in combination with the DNA encoding rules, and then the four DNA planes are subjected to row circular permutation and column circular permutation. After that, the diffusion operation on each DNA plane is performed. Finally, the four DNA planes are decoded and then combined into a pixel matrix, that is, the final cipher image is obtained. Throughout the encryption process, the choice of DNA encoding and decoding rules is determined by the PBSG system. Simulation results and security analysis show that the algorithm not only has good encryption effect, but also can resist various classic attacks, and has excellent security performance.
What problem does this paper attempt to address?